Argos

Argos is an online retailer with multiple channels in the UK offers a wide variety of products. Founded in 1973, it provides everything from toys and technology to furniture and homeware. Customers can browse the catalog at their own pace and select what they want to purchase and then go to the nearest store to purchase.

The company's Sampling Program allows suppliers to receive feedback from customers on their products. This allows them to identify ways to improve the design of their products or messages. All brands are welcome to sample, regardless of their size or share of market.

Argos, one of the British high-street favorite that has been around for more than 50 years, is famous for its catalogue style shopping experience. Argos was among the first retailers to launch a website. It is now the UK's third most popular online store. Argos' success in brick-and mortar sales and online is due to its extensive investment in store technology which includes replacing laminated catalogues with kiosks that are digital. The retailer also offers click-and-collect services in its stores and it operates a number of Argos' shop-in-shops within supermarket chains.

Debenhams

Debenhams one of the oldest department stores in the UK, was established in Wigmore street in London in 1778. It was initially an expensive drapers shop. The company has since grown to become an important player in the British retail industry, with more than 200 stores across the world and exclusive partnerships with top designers Jasper Conran and Julien Macdonald.

In 1985 the retailer was taken over by Burton Group, which later joined forces with the Arcadia retail empire, which was headed by Sir Philip Green. Within a few years, the company's profits fell and debts ballooned since the retailer was entangled into expensive long-term lease agreements.

In 2021 the brand was bought by online rival Boohoo and its physical stores closed. In the last two years, only four out of the ten former Debenhams stores in GB have been renovated. The remaining stores remain empty. Some of the stores that were once there have been converted into mixed-use developments, while others have been used for different brands such as Next Beauty Hall and The Range. Wales has the most reoccupied ex-Debenhams sites followed by Northern Ireland and the Midlands.

House of Fraser

House of Fraser, a department store chain that was established in Glasgow in 1849, is located in Scotland. It started as a drapery shop and then expanded to include variety of goods like luggage and shoes. The company later expanded by acquiring rivals like Bentalls. The company expanded its own clothing line, and introduced the Linea label.

Despite their expansion, House of Fraser continued to struggle with the evolving shopping habits of UK consumers. Their financial woes were made worse by the rise of online retailers and the decline of traditional high-street stores. The company also had too much stock and a huge debt burden.

In 2003, Tom Hunter made a hostile bid for the group with the possibility of combining it with Allders, a different department store in which he had shareholdings. In the course of this time, a number of House of Fraser shops in Scotland were shut down or sold. The company was eventually bought by Mike Ashley, who planned to change the name of the company Frasers and create new stores. This acquisition has resulted in some supplier relationships being damaged, which has caused uncertainty for the company.
